For the incoming director: this memo summarises the proposed joint venture between Corvane Materials and Telsward Fabrication to manufacture the Ironbell composite panel in the Navik region. Ownership would split 55/45 in our favour, with capital contributions phased over two years. Legal review has cleared the draft framework; antitrust exposure is judged minimal. The steering group meets monthly. Please review the full proposal pack before signing. The confidential strategic rationale appears directly below.

board note of bahaf-kahif: Gross margin on Wenael came in at 10 percent against a plan of 15 percent. Only 7 of the 120 pilot accounts renewed Wenael, so a churn review is set for July 1.

**Build provenance: Lanternlink deep-link routing**

This page explains how plugin authors verify which Lanternlink router build handles their registered URI patterns on Fennic Mobile. Routing rules are compiled into the app at build time, so a pattern that works in your sandbox may not exist in an older production build. Always confirm provenance before filing a routing bug: open the diagnostics pane in any Fennic build and compare against the published manifest. The reference build for the current plugin SDK is identified by the token below.

session token of tajef-bageg = htk21_5d90d574934f3ccae6437

## Fan-out backpressure — support runbook

When the Pingwell notification fan-out queue exceeds its watermark, downstream delivery slows deliberately; this is expected backpressure, not an outage. Confirm by checking the queue_depth gauge before escalating. If depth stays elevated past ten minutes, inspect the subscriber offsets table directly. Connect to the fan-out metadata store using the string below.

database URL for bagap-yahap: mysql://druax_svc:s0i8rHw@db-fdc1.orvexworks.local:5432/druius

# Basement Archive Room — Night Access

The archive room under Pellworth House holds old contracts and the tape backups. Night shift: take stairwell C, not the lift (it's switched off after midnight). Lights are on a timer by the door — slap the button as you go in. Sign the logbook, even at 3am, yes really. The keypad by the door takes the code below.

staff pass of fahap-tajeg = bdg-FT-6